About The Position

Regional Managers oversee everything that happens within the 4 walls of all the stores within their assigned region- no matter if it’s regarding FOH to BOH or from salary to hourly. The Regional Manager balances being an advocate for their employees, while supporting the operational practices, core values, and company culture of The Salty. The Store Manager and Executive Pastry Chef of each store reports to the Regional Manager. This role interacts with all their employees by frequently having in-store check-ins in order to ensure that the Store Managers and Executive Pastry Chefs are doing their jobs correctly, the stores are clean, the donuts and coffee are beautiful and tasty, and that The Salty’s core values are being instilled throughout all positions. To be a successful Regional Manager is to be a good leader. This position reports directly to The Director of Operations.

Responsibilities

  • Developing internal succession plans and a deep bench of managers at all levels of store operations by continually focusing on the development of your Store Managers.
  • Driving continuous performance improvement focusing on leading indicators. You must be balanced in your approach focusing on people, financial, and customer experience - equally.
  • Training, coaching, and inspiring all locations to deliver exceptional customer experiences and high-quality culinary operations ensuring a commitment to The Salty’s operational policies and procedures.
  • Leading Store Manager’s development both personally and professionally through goal setting, coaching and feedback, and always connecting development to improved performance.
  • Fostering a positive, team-oriented environment with a healthy competitive spirit that ensures the sharing of best practices and a commitment to goal achievement.
  • Maintaining the highest level of professionalism in the workplace. You are an advocate for your employees, all while supporting the operational practices, core values, and company culture of The Salty.
  • Treating your stores as your home. When you enter a given store, it’s your responsibility to be aware of all the small details to make sure that nothing is missed.
  • You must make it a priority for both yourself and your managers to be tasting donuts and coffee regularly.
  • You are the store's failsafe, the buck stops with you- meaning that you need to address issues in an effective and efficient manner.
  • You work with multiple stores and managers across your region, driving many miles to coordinate in-store check-ins/visits and reviews.
  • Responsible for delivering/exceeding budget, top-line sales, financial metrics, productivity & production management. Active management of P&L in collaboration with Store Managers, Executive Pastry Chefs, Director of Finance & greater team including but not limited to purchasing control (COGS, packaging, etc.), vendor management (SYSCO, landscaping, janitorial services), scheduling labor to sales & more
  • On a weekly basis on/before 11am on Sunday before the week starts, you will send out ‘Quantity Reports’ to each of the stores within your region.
  • Review/audit payroll submission from the Store Managers
  • You are the ‘customer service’ for Sharepoint for your Store Managers. It’s important that you keep all documents up to date.
  • Regularly checking Google Drive that the appropriate leaders were inputted into Google Drive and are actively using it.
  • It’s your responsibility to be consistently check Zenput of all your stores to ensure that your managers, including the Executive Pastry Chefs, are submitting their lists correctly and on time.
  • On Zenput you’ll also find weekly/monthly/quarterly tasks that have been assigned to you. It’s expected that you complete these lists on time and accurately.
  • Being active and responsive in Asana - which includes staying on top of due dates for all tasks.
  • Being active and responsive in your email.
  • Understanding how Front works and actively assigning emails and responding to tags.
  • Being active and responsive in Teams.
  • Your responsibility is to ensure that all licenses and permits are paid for and renewed on time for each store in your region. This also includes any licenses and permits for vehicles as well.
  • Regional Managers are responsible for helping implement coffee changes given to them in collaboration with their Store Managers. More specifically, Regional Managers are responsible for:
  • COGS + Gross margin for all beverages
  • Quality of coffee and beverages within their assigned locations
  • Ensuring that all stores are stocked with the appropriate uniforms. Meaning that Managers have the embroidered denim shirt, Pastry Chefs have the embroidered chefs coat, and that all other employees have the store uniform tee.
  • Ensuring that pricing on Uber Eats + POS systems are accurate to the printed menus.
  • The Store Managers and ASM’s keep track of the merchandise inventory on a week to week basis on Zenput and Toast, but it’s your responsibility to ensure that they’re accurate and that inventory aligns with in store inventory.
